Hamed Sulliman, born in Aden, was a British subject. He had a British father which could have influenced his decision to come and settle in the UK. He came to South Shields as a seaman, working as a fireman when he was called up for the war. For his loyal service, he received the Mercantile Marine War Medal.
Here is the discharge document which cites Sulliman along with several other Yemeni seamen from South Shields, their ships and service.
